SCAGLIONE v. JUNEAU

No. 2010-C-1734.

40 So.3d 127 (2010)

Judith S. SCAGLIONE and Raymond C. Doran, Jr. v. Jeanne Nunez JUNEAU, individually and in her capacity as Candidate for the Office of Circuit Judge for the Fourth Circuit Court of Appeal, and Lena R. Torres, in her capacity as Clerk of Court for the Thirty-Fourth Judicial District Court for the Parish of St. Bernard, State of Louisiana.

Supreme Court of Louisiana.

July 27, 2010.


PER CURIAM.*

Writ granted. The district court's ruling maintaining the peremptory exception of peremption is reversed, and the matter is remanded to the district court for further proceedings.
